What is J2se and J2EE?
J2SE is a Java Platform, Standard Edition software is the premier platform for rapidly developing secure, portable applications that run on server and desktop systems spanning most operating systems. It provides perfect platform to develop windows and web application with flexibility that these programs can be executed with any operating system. " XPERT INFOTECH provides java training according to the current requirement of IT industry. "
Java 2 enterprise Edition (J2EE) is a platform for building distributed, scalable, platform independent server side Enterprise Applications.Java is the most popular platform independent and Object Oriented Language. The Java programming language is a true object-oriented (OOPs) programming language. The main implication of this statement is that in order to write programs, you must work within its object-oriented structure.
We prepare the course which covered all the topic of Java with point of view of Java professionals. We also keep in mind the topic which covered by sun-certification and try to make you perfect for certification. We covered all necessary topic of object-oriented programming in Java and this is the strong reason for you to trust our courses. Ashish Kumar, Java Developer
"Since 1995, Sun Microsystems has released seven major revisions of the Java Development Kit."
Ashish Kumar, Java Developer
XPERT INFOTECH is a Java Training institute with proven expertise in training useful java applications as well as providing hands-on training to budding java developers. We have a dedicated team of experienced java trainers who provide intensive and dedicated training on all core and general aspects of java development. We have mastered the Java programming and can effortlessly transfer our skills and knowledge to you through our java training course.
Before going through Advance Java live project training candidate should have knowledge of given concepts listed below:
- Student should have good knowledge of a modern, object oriented language such as C++, C#.
- Methods, functions, object oriented concepts should be cleared.
- Should have good knowledge of DBMS and RDBMS concepts.
Java Training provided by Real-time JAVA Application Developer of our company, has more than 6-7 years of domain experience.
- We will provide real time project training with code explanation and implementati.
- Our training modules are completely designed according to current IT market.
- Student will go through the training of OOPs concept and DBMS, RDBMS concepts as complimentary package before starting of Java Training.
- We offer regular, fast track and weekend training in Java training.
- Study material is provided with the course which consists of concepts, examples and real time examples.
After completion of Java training by Xpert Infotech, students can easily develop and deploy your own real-time java application.
Benefits of Courses
- After completion of Java training students can easily able to use object-oriented.
- features of the Java language, such as encapsulation, inheritance and polymorphism.
- Use Java technology data types and expressions.
- Use Java technology flow control constructs.
- Use arrays and other data collections.
- Implement error-handling techniques using exception handling.
- Can easily create GUI applications using Swing components: panels, buttons, labels, text fields, and text areas.
- Create multithreaded programs.
XPERT INFOTECH provide real time project training with code explanation and implementation.
Our training modules are completely designed according to current IT market.
J2se and J2ee Development Training Syllabus
- What is java?
- Object oriented programming
- Internet programming
- Platform Independency
- Internet Security
- C,C++ VS Java
- OOPs concept , its properties and uses
- Defining methods and variables in java
- Class Member and instance members
- Java First Program
- Role of Constructor
- Use of Final Keywords
- Memory Management Using Garbage collector
- Overloading and Overriding
- Use of this and supper Keywords
- Dynamic Binding and Static Binding
- Runtime Polymorphism and its Power
- Abstract class and Interfaces
- Inner / Nested classes and its uses
- Introduction to Enterprise Edition
- Distributed Multitier Applications
- J2EE Containers
- Web Services Support
- Packaging Applications
- J2EE 1.4 APIs
- What is Web Application?
- What Is a Servlet?
- Servlet Life Cycle
- Sharing Information
- Using Scope Objects
- Controlling Concurrent Access
- Getting Information from Requests
- Constructing Responses
- Filtering Requests and Responses
- Programming Filters
- Customized Requests and Responses
- Specifying Filter Mappings
- Invoking Other Web Resources
- Including Other Resources in the Response
- Transferring Control
- Accessing the Web Context
- Maintaining Client State
- Session Management
- Session Tracking
- JavaServer Pages Technology
- The Life Cycle of a JSP Page
- Translation and Compilation
- Creating Static Content
- Jsp Basic Tags and its uses
- Creating Dynamic Content
- Using Objects within JSP Pages
- Expression Language
- Deactivating Expression Evaluation
- Implicit Objects
- Custom Tags
- JavaBeans Components
- Reusing Content in JSP Pages
- Java Mail API
- XML and Web Services
- Introduction to Struts 2.x
- MVC and Struts 2 Architecture
- Actions, Results & Interceptors
- Object Graph Navigation Language (OGNL)
- Struts 2 Presentation Tags
- Role of ActionInvocation and ActionContext
- Manipulating data on ValueStack
- Creating Custom Interceptors and Results
- Validating Action Properties
- Generating Composite Views using Tiles
- Using Annotations to specify Configuration
- Introduction to ORM and Hibernate
- Hibernate Architecture
- Hibernate Configuration
- Introduction to Session and SessionFactory
- Persisting Objects using Hibernate
- Hibernate Query Language
- Inheritance Mapping
- Bidirectional Association Mapping
- Caching Introduction
- Implementing Second Level Caching using EHCACHE
- Integrating Spring & Hibernate
- Integrating Struts & Hibernate
- Integrating JPA & Hibernate
- Introduction to Spring
- Understanding Inversion of Control (IOC) and
- Dependency Injection (DI)
- Spring Architecture
- Implementing IOC in Spring
- Understanding Aspect Oriented Programming (AOP)
- Implementing AOP in Spring
- Introduction to Template Design Pattern
- Simplifying Data access using JDBC Template
- Abstracting Data Access Layer using DAO
- Introduction to Spring MVC
- Tomcat, Weblogic and Glassfish Application Server will be used for this training.
- Eclipse, NetBeans IDE will be used for application development.
- 8 Weeks : Monday to Friday (4 Days + 1 Day Week Off)
- 02 Hours : Practical Session per Day
- 50 Hours : Classroom Sessions
- 14 Hours : Project Sessions
- Project : Work on Multi-Projects
- 8 Weeks : Saturday and Sunday basis(2 Days/Week)
- 04 Hours : Practical Session per Day
- 50 Hours : Classroom Sessions
- 14 Hours : Project Sessions
- Project : Work on Multi-Projects
Major and Mini Projects Scenario under the guidance of our Well experienced J2se and J2ee Developer
Connect World Project
Connect World provides a common platform to share the common people experiences, informations all over the world and people can discuss on any topic created by only registered user. Moreover, users can give the advice on any topic or report. Admin Can create and post the topic to be discussed and report respectively after getting logged in and Can delete any report which looks like abusive matters.
Online Exam Project in Java
In this project, there are given Some questions to play. User can bookmark any question for the reconsideration while going to result.We are using here java array to store the questions, options and answers not database. You can use collection framework or database in place of array.
The Airline reservation system Java Project
Airline reservation system Java Project reduces the scope of manual error and conveniently maintains any modifications, cancellations in the reservations. It not only provides flight details but also creates a platform to book tickets, cancels or modifies ticket timings or dates and informs about the number of people on board.The software is divided into 4 parts with each having their respective functions.
Video Conferencing a Java Project
This project is based on video transmission as well as reception. With the aid of this project, two or more persons can chat in an Intranet with one another. Along with this, the option of video conferencing is also provided too.The project is programmed using the programming language JAVA. Along with this, Java development kit, Java media framework. This is an entire package which can be used to develop software's relating to audio and video. Through this package, one can capture the media data and transmitting to the target device.
Net Banking System Project in Java
Dynamic Heterogeneous Grid Computing
Dynamic Heterogeneous Grid Computing Communication Induced Check-pointing protocols usually make the assumption that any process can be check-pointed at any time. An alternative approach which releases the constraints of always check-point able processes, without delaying or altering message ordering enforcement by the communication layer and by the application.This protocol has been implemented within Pro-Active, an open source Java middle ware for asynchronous and distributed objects implementing the ASP.
- After being hands-on in projects as well as J2se and J2ee Development concepts students will go through interview preparation and recruitment process in IT Industry.
- Xpert Infotech is 100% Job oriented with placements training Institute in Delhi NCR.
- Xpert Infotech have dedicated placement teams at Noida, Delhi, Gurgaon.
- Xpert Infotech have satisfactorily met the requirements of over 30 company, and they include some of the popular names such as Accenture, Sapient, Xperia Technologies Pvt. Ltd, Ajani Infotech Pvt Ltd, Silver Leaf, HyTech Professionals and many others.
Our expertise extends to guiding you through every step of your admission process: from the choice of Courses, to applying with discretion and guiding you through immigration procedures, Educational services, such as guidance and consultations.
- Why Xpert Infotech
- Who Can Attend
- Group (or) Inhouse Training
- Group Discounts
Updated with the Latest Technologies
- Xpert Infotech strives to keep our students updated with the latest development technologies in the world of IT.
- 30+ Courses: We provide solutions through a variety of training Courses Microsoft.net, PHP, CMS, iOS, Java, Oracle, Soft Skills and a lot more.
- We take pride in our consistency in providing excellent service and facilities to our students.
- Our faculty of experienced trainers are outstanding performers who bring about a positive difference in our students' career graphs.
30+ Company: We have satisfactorily met the requirements of over 30 company, and they include some of the popular names such as Accenture, Sapient, Xperia Technologies Pvt. Ltd, Ajani Infotech Pvt Ltd, Silver Leaf, HyTech Professionals and many others.
Group Training OR Inhouse Training
Live Virtual Classroom or Online Classroom: With online classroom training, you have the option to attend the course remotely from your desktop via video conferencing. This format saves productivity challenges and decreases your time spent away from work or home.
Online Self-Learning: In this mode, you will receive the lecture videos and you can go through the course as per your convenience.
XPERT INFOTECH have group discount options for our training program in J2se and J2ee Application Development.
- One student is free with Ten students.
- Complimentary package of C, C++.
- Free Study Material.
- Free Demo Classes.
We have extensive experience working with individuals and employees as they make successful work and life transitions and are dedicated to helping you make the changes you want in your work and your life.
XPERT INFOTECH group of professional give you group discount and Eco-friendly Environment.Our customer service representatives will be able to give you more details. Contact us using the form on the left of Contact us page on the Xpert Infotech website.
Professional and Dependable Consultant in India
On successful completion of the program the candidate would get a Certificate from XPERT INFOTECH and also could land with Job Opportunities in the XPERT INFOTECH, affiliates and group Companies. XPERT INFOTECH has a full-fledged Placements Team in place.
The Team is in touch with all our students completing the course on different technologies. On receiving recruitment request, the Team screens & shortlists candidates & sends them for tests/ interviews to the company.
Our expertise extends to guiding you through every step
- Anyone who wants to develop their career for Java Application Development.
- Anyone who hava knowledge of C, Java.
- Anyone who wants improve accessibility by using the features of website Create a user interface.
- Anyone who wants to Placed in IT Inustry.
Anyone who wants to develop their career for decision-making can pursue this training. This skills-intensive course is ideal for Java Application Development, Software Developer, Software Services Developer and recommendations.
What are the components of J2EE application?
A J2EE component is a self-contained functional software unit that is assembled into a J2EE application with its related classes and files and communicates with other components.
What is Hibernate?
Hibernate an open source Java persistence framework project. Perform powerful object relational mapping and query databases using HQL and SQL.
What is Spring?
Spring is a light weight open source framework for the development of enterprise application that resolves the complexity of enterprise application development also providing a cohesive framework for J2EE application development. Which is primarily based on IOC (inversion of control) or DI (dependency injection) design pattern.
What is HQL?
Hibernate Query Language (HQL) is an object-oriented query language, similar to SQL, but instead of operating on tables and columns, HQL works with persistent objects and their properties. HQL queries are translated by Hibernate into conventional SQL queries which in turns perform action on database.
What is JSP?
JavaServer Pages (JSP) is a technology that helps software developers create dynamically generated web pages based on HTML, XML, or other document types. Released in 1999 by Sun Microsystems, JSP is similar to PHP, but it uses the Java programming language.
Can I cancel my enrollment? Will I get a refund?
Kindly go through our Refund Policy for more details: http://www.xpertinfotech.in/refund
What payment options are available?
Payments can be made using any of the Visa Credit or Debit card, MasterCard, American Express, PayPal. You will be emailed a receipt after the payment is made.
I had like to learn more about this training program. Who should I contact?
Contact us using the form on the right of any page on the Xpert Infotech website. Our customer service representatives will be able to give you more details.
How will I get my course completion certificate from Xpert infotech?
Your course completion certificate will be sent to you once you meet these criteria:
- Submit the projects per course requirements in Java Development Training
- Successfully meet the project evaluation criteria set by Xpert infotech experts
Is there a setup fee?
Kindly go through our fee structure for more details: http://www.xpertinfotech.in/feestructure